The 9 striking performances along with a funny and “fruity” debut performance by the host Katy Perry, the 2008 MTV Europe Music Awards was a blast last night. Between the performances the pranks and chaff from the VIP bar at the Glamour Pit added to the wit of the show.
The 15th MTV Europe Music Awards was opened by Katy Perry, who came riding on a Cherry Chapstick surrounded by cheerleaders in a performance of ‘I Kissed A Girl’. Beyoncé stole the hearts of millions with her third performance at MTV EMAs. She fascinated the audience with a heartwarming performance of new single ‘If I Were A Boy’. Take That was a show stealer even after their 15 years break. They made a come back to the EMAs hypnotizing the audience with an exclusive first performance of their new single, ‘Greatest Day’. The Killers performed ‘Human’ in a steel box installation that came with an arresting three dimensional visual. The versatility of the set was revealed after the screen was unveiled up to reveal the performance of the band.
Among the debutant performers Kanye West and Estelle both made a remarkable entry. They performed ‘Love Lockdown,’ and ‘American Boy’ in style with full vigor. The Ting Tings, also had their debut performance, who performed their hit single, ‘That’s Not My Name’. ‘So Hot’, the new single of Kid Rock, received huge applaud from the audience. Duffy performed ‘Mercy’, which was her debut performance in the MTV Europe Music Awards. The Wombats rocked the stage with a performance of a cover version of Leona Lewis’ ‘Bleeding Love’, establishing the MTV’s love affair with Liverpool yet another time.
The closing performance by P!nk added to the grandeur of the fifteenth MTV Europe Music Awards. Her spectacularly energetic performance of ‘So What’ simply stormed the audience. Raving from the glamour pit through the crowds to the stage, P!nk was soon joined by over 30 crazy fans who ended up in a pillow fight. In the end the whole audience were showered with 40,000 4-inch white feathers.
